Naples New Year’s Day traffic stop turns up large drug stash

Summary by WFTX
The Naples Police Department says a routine traffic stop in the early morning hours of New Years Day led to the seizure of a large amount of illegal drugs, including fentanyl. According to police, officers stopped a vehicle on January 1, 2026, after it failed to stop at a flashing red traffic signal at 3rd Street South and Broad Avenue South.Police say officers smelled marijuana while speaking with the occupants and observed suspicious behavior …
